Abstract

The present study aims to investigate the use of role-play activities to enhance speaking skills of the first-year English major students at University of Khanh Hoa. An 8-week study was carried out and 30 first-year students of the English Linguistic class A at University of Khanh Hoa received role-play’s implementation in their speaking class. The research data were collected through questionnaires to all participants and classroom observation of the two students. The findings of the study indicate that most of the students came to admit the benefits of role-play in speaking lesson as it is an interesting, beneficial, effective and innovative activity. Particularly, the study results show many positive signs of learners’ improvement of their speaking skills. Furthermore, through the research, the author has found interesting speaking topics for their students as well as their difficulties and then has given some recommendations to improve the role-play activity in the classroom.
